About meMrs. GREEN APPLE

It’s a grand ode to life that portrays both its brilliance and its cruelty as they are, yet still sings of the preciousness of living.

Released in January 2019 as the eighth single by the rock band Mrs.

GREEN APPLE, it is also included on their fourth album, “Attitude.” The song was written as the support anthem for the 97th All Japan High School Soccer Tournament and also drew attention as a Calorie Mate commercial song.

Its powerful message, which affirms not only days that aren’t all good but even efforts that go unrewarded, is sure to resonate deeply with graduates taking their next step.

It’s perfect for times when you want to face yourself or celebrate each other’s hard-fought efforts with friends.

Belt out the chorus, and you’ll definitely feel energy welling up for tomorrow!

Dear,Snow Man

Snow Man, who captivate fans with performances that blend high-level dance skills and acrobatics.

This is a heartwarming ballad included on their first best-of album, “THE BEST 2020 – 2025,” released in January 2025, written as a message of gratitude to their fans.

It’s filled with feelings for the people who have supported them over the five years since their debut, and its gently spoken melody really resonates in your heart.

The lyrics overflow with straightforward words of thanks, making it perfect for expressing your feelings to teachers and friends during graduation season.

With a comfortable mid-tempo that’s easy to sing, it’s ideal when you want to perform with sincerity.

Choose it as the closing song at karaoke with your closest friends, and you’re sure to end the night wrapped in a warm, heartfelt atmosphere!

A song by imase that speaks in down-to-earth words to a generation taking its first steps into adulthood.

Written in April 2023 as the theme for Suntory’s web video “Otona Jan・Koko kara dane 04,” this track is a gentle cheer for those whose youth didn’t go as they’d hoped during the pandemic.

It’s also included on the May 2024 album Bonsai, and its comfortable beat and melody will blow away your anxieties.

With a brightness that makes you feel the real show of life starts now, it’s perfect for getting together and singing after graduation.

Let’s imagine a future full of hope and celebrate with smiles!

BE:FIRST’s “Bye-Good-Bye” overflows with positive energy that turns the loneliness of parting into fuel for a new step forward.

Its lyrics reframe “goodbye” not as an ending, but as the starting line to a brilliant future—sure to give you courage! Released in May 2022 as their second single, the song also became beloved as the theme for NTV’s morning drama on ZIP!, “Before We Say Goodbye: Fantastic 31 Days.” By September 2022, it had surpassed 100 million total streams, cementing its overwhelming popularity.

Its bright, refreshing pop melody makes it perfect for singing with smiles at karaoke after a graduation ceremony!

Primal.THE YELLOW MONKEY

Do you know a rock track perfect for graduation season, where a hint of melancholy drifts beneath a glamorous sound? It’s a song by THE YELLOW MONKEY, one of Japan’s leading rock bands.

Released in January 2001 as their 24th single just before the band went on hiatus, it had no tie-in at the time, yet became a long-running hit thanks to its timeless appeal.

It’s included on releases such as the album “GOLDEN YEARS Singles 1996-2001.” During their 2016 reunion tour, it was performed as the opening number, serving as a bridge between the end of the past and a new beginning.

With its rich, layered production featuring Tony Visconti, just singing it will give you a rush of exhilaration.

Why not channel Kazuya Yoshii’s sultry style and sing it for a friend embarking on a new chapter?

I won’t let you say goodbye.B’z

This is the song that blows away the sadness of farewells during graduation season and fills you with a positive spirit.

Though it’s not a single but an album track by the nationally beloved B’z, it has remained a cherished classic among fans for many years.

The lyrics, which refuse to make parting eternal and convey a strong will that “we’ll meet again,” resonate deeply through Tak Matsumoto’s melodies and Koshi Inaba’s powerful vocals.

Included on the album RUN released in October 1992, it even ranked 8th in the 2008 fan-voted best-of list—proof of its unquestionable popularity.

It’s not just for quiet reflection; it’s perfect for the moment when you want to move on to the next stage with your friends, smiling—so belt it out with all your heart!

Sparkle, sparkle!Kishidan

Kishidan is a band performing in their own unique style called Yank Rock.

Released in February 2004, this song has long been loved as a graduation-season staple.

While painting scenes of classrooms and desks, it doesn’t just dwell on memories—it’s infused with a strong will to charge into the future.

Rather than a somber farewell, its fiery message makes you want to raise your voice and sing with your friends, giving powerful support to anyone setting off on a new path.

Also included on the album “TOO FAST TO LIVE TOO YOUNG TO DIE,” the track features parts perfect for group singing, making it ideal for livening up a karaoke session.

When you want to blow away anxiety and loneliness and graduate with a smile, link arms with your friends and sing it together!
